#43949 01/07/2003 5:20 PM | Joined: Oct 2002 Posts: 29 Junior Member | | Junior Member Joined: Oct 2002 Posts: 29 | I just had a similar problem and I found the exhaust valve in cylinder #6 had sunk into the head. This caused me to have no compression in cyl. 6. The machine shop installed new hardened valve seats and the usual work to clean up everything. I am almost done reassembling the head.
